Five of us will be down there for the week of April 29 - May 6 on a Moorings 433 PC. If we leave the docks in Road Town by noon on Saturday, the 29th, where would be a good first night's stay? And, second question, where will there be live bands playing during the week we're there? <img src="http://www.traveltalkonline.com/forums/images/graemlins/band.gif" alt="" />

Power Cat pretty much leaves you wide open for first night options. Lots of live music to be had at Cane Garden Bay most weeks. I might head over to Cooper Island for your first night and then make your way up to Leverick Bay for the Michael Beans show -- he will be in his last week of performances (I believe he finishes the 3rd? someone here will know for sure) and if you haven't been to his Happy Arrrrrrrrr....you really should!

Thanks, Bridget. We're thinking about heading on over to Jost Van Dyke for our first night, Saturday, and then to Norman Island on Sunday. Monday we'll head up to Leverick Bay in time for the Michael Beans show, then Tuesday morning we'll taxi to the Baths and then spend Tuesday night at Saba Rock. Wednesday we'll head out early for Anegada, Thursday at Cane Garden Bay and Friday, our last night, at Cooper. We'll be eating dinner out most nights and stopping along the way for snorkeling. How does this itinerary sound to you?

I might do Norman first on Saturday (maybe snorkel the Caves?) and then do Jost on Sunday -- you've got a better chance of White Bay not being a complete zoo on a Sunday (although good luck with that anyway these days...) You could get an early start on Sunday for Jost and snorkel the Indians on your way out of Norman.

Probably easier to power your way to Leverick from JVD - you can stop and hit the Dogs along your way for another good snorkel.

Limin Times can be a good source of entertainment info. You can pick up a hard copy at many BVI venues.
